Bio

Yang Poyoyo Shaohan (or Erica) is a Chinese Dota 2 player. He is the OGA OGA Dota PIT Season 3: China. He reached the 10,000 MMR mark in February 2021. His signature hero is Phantom Assassin.

Poyoyo started his professional career in October 2018, when he played under the nickname Erica for KG.Luminous. In a year and a half in the team, he has established himself as a good kerry at the dash-3 level. The biggest achievement for poyoyo in KG.Luminous was winning Elite Challenge Season 3, after which he received an invitation to Keen Gaming - the main squad of the organization. The player was supposed to improve the team's results in the "online era", but the team could not rise above 7-8 places in local leagues.

In September 2020, poyoyo moved to Vici Gaming, where he temporarily replaced 23savage, who needed time to adapt to the new style of play and improve his Chinese language skills. After bronze at China Dota2 Pro Cup Season 1 and gold at OGA Dota PIT Season 3: China, as well as the failed experience with the Thai kerry, the club management decided to keep gamer in the squad. Yang changed the nickname Erica to the familiar poyoyo, and then began to prepare for the upcoming DPC season. None of the analysts considered Vici Gaming as the main favorite of their region, but the team never ceased to surprise - two bronze medals on Dota Pro Circuit 2021: Season 1 - China Upper Division and Dota Pro Circuit 2021: Season 2 - China: Upper Division, as well as fourth place on WePlay AniMajor guaranteed the Chinese tag a direct invitation to The International 10. Upon returning home, the players were given some time off before participating in i-League 2021 and i-League 2021 Season 2, where they lost twice in the finals to Team Aster. In September 2021, the full team went to a bootcamp in Europe to prepare for The International 10.

Since November 11, 2023, he has been representing Team Aster at the kerry position, but with no results so far.
